English: Accompanying note: "Former Gov. Jeb Bush speaks at a news conference January 14, 2010, in the governor's conference room at the Florida Capitol, regarding an initiative to improve education in Florida. Former House Speaker Allan Bense, R-Panama City, (L) and Gov. Charlie Crist (R) apparently found something amusing in the former governor's remarks." |
